1980 Alfa Romeo GTV 1977 Chevrolet Monte Carlo
Make Alfa Romeo Chevrolet
Model GTV Monte Carlo
Year Released 1980 1977
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 2492 cc 5001 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 8 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Horse Power 158 HP 0 HP
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Number of Seats 4 seats 5 seats
Vehicle Weight 1210 kg 1555 kg
Vehicle Length 4270 mm 5100 mm
Vehicle Width 1670 mm 1790 mm
Vehicle Height 1340 mm 1380 mm
Wheelbase Size 2410 mm 2750 mm
